    After looking more closely on GB, all models labeled as preban and bringing a high price have a slant brake. I was unable to find any rifles with a birdcage. They also have the RPK47 marking intact. Furniture is all over the place with different types and finishes. If the evil slant brake and threads were removed during the ban why would the bayo lug be intact? Also if the slant brake and threads were removed that would have to mean that someone re-threaded the barrel and added the birdcage? I am no expert and this is kind of confusing.     FWIW
    "Basically these were pre 89 guns caught in customs when the ban went into effect........to get them out and be able to sell them, Mitchell and ATF came to a agreement to bring them up to the then new current regs.......Mitchell scrubbed the original AK-47 + RPK-47 markings which were banned by name....and replaced with " m-90" - model 90.......they also had to remove original stock sets , pin flash hiders in place, remove nite sites, shave sides of bayonet lug...The original stock sets were usually included in the box and were later approved by the ATF to put them back on the gun- There is a letter somewhere online attesting to this .....Great guns i have a Few M90 mitchells , and a bunch of the pre 89 ones as well........ Essentially same gun...... You cannot compare these to the current kit guns/U.S. builds......"
